It was a Sunday morning in August when Teesha and her husband headed out on a bicycle. They wheeled through a village that had a church building, and as they rode by, Teesha glanced inside. What she saw caught her eye. Believers clapped their hands and worshiped the Lord with joy. It was here that Teesha’s tiresome journey came to an end.

Exhausting Options

In 2015, Teesha began to suffer from severe joint pain. The pain became so intense that her husband took her to the hospital. Teesha stayed there for two days as medication was administered to her. Surely, they thought, medicine will help and this condition will go away.

But Teesha’s condition only grew worse and the pain more intense. After Teesha was released from the hospital, she sought what she believed was her only other option: a priest.
